Well, it depends! I have a smokin' recommendation at under $800, but it's tubes! The Cayin TA-30 from BizzyBee Audio is a really great sounding integrated amp. I've owned at least 15 different integrated amps that retail for $600-$2500 and the Cayin is my favorite.

If you require Solid State, I would recommend buying used and getting a Bryston B-60. It is a very smooth sounding unit and can sometimes be bought for under $1000 used. It comes with a transferable 20 year warranty, so he should be covered for many years.

I've also owned the Arcam Alpha 10 Integrated which I actually preferred over the Bryston because of its good sound and funtionality. They can be purchased used for $600-750. The Alpha 10 was replaced with the Arcam Diva 85, which gets great reviews. Also, the Creek 5053SE gets great reviews and can sometimes be bought used for under $1000.
